
Tortellini Soup Recipe
BARS = SHARE OF RECIPE CALORIES · RINGS = FDA DV
A rich tomato broth filled with shredded chicken, tender vegetables, and cheese-filled tortellini. This comforting one-pot soup makes a complete meal and can be made on the stovetop or slow cooker.

Ingredients
serves 6-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 large onion (diced)
- 5 large carrots (peeled and chopped)
- 5 stalks celery (chopped)
- 5 cloves garlic (minced)
- 2 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 1 (14.5 ounce) can tomato sauce
- 2 bay leaves
- 8 cups low-sodium chicken broth (or homemade chicken stock)
- 2 cups shredded chicken (plus more, as needed)
- 5 ounces baby spinach
- 1 (20 ounce) package refrigerated cheese tortellini
- salt + pepper (to season)
- Fresh thyme (to garnish)
- crushed red pepper (to garnish)
